
934 Gallery is a 100% volunteer run non-profit art gallery. Our volunteers are a critical part of our ability to deliver on our mission.
OUR MISSION
934 Gallery’s mission is to provide relevant programming as a publicly accessible arts anchor within the neighborhood fabric of Milo-Grogan; to foster an interest in the arts among all ages in the local community; to provide a space for programming that will showcase the skills of emerging visual & performance artists; & to provide established artists recognition among the greater community.
